The supporting mechanism comprises a supporting plate 10 movably connected with the lower surface of a rolling bearing 9, a supporting rod 11 is fixedly connected to the lower surface of the supporting plate 10, reinforcing rods 12 which are symmetrically distributed are fixedly connected to the rod wall of the supporting rod 11, the top ends of the reinforcing rods 12 are fixedly connected with the lower surface of the supporting plate 10, the structure can improve the stability of building the template, and the quality of fixing the template is improved.
The rod wall of the bolt 6 is movably sleeved with a cushion block 13, and the cushion block 13 enlarges the contact area between the bolt 6 and the fixed plate 2, so that the fixed template body 1 of the fixed plate 2 is more stable.
The lower surface of bolt 6 is fixedly connected with two twist bars 14 that the symmetry distributes, and twist bar 14 is convenient for rotate bolt 6, reaches laborsaving effect.
The upper surface of the supporting plate 10 is fixedly connected with a rubber pad, and the rubber pad increases the friction force of the contact surface, so that the supporting structure is more stably connected.
The outer wall fixedly connected with dwang 15 of a screw thread section of thick bamboo 8, dwang 15 be convenient for the staff rotate a screw thread section of thick bamboo 8.

The formwork fixing structure for the arched structure construction of a house building according to claim 1, wherein the supporting mechanism comprises a supporting plate (10) movably connected with the lower surface of the rolling bearing (9), a supporting rod (11) is fixedly connected with the lower surface of the supporting plate (10), two symmetrically distributed reinforcing rods (12) are fixedly connected with the rod wall of the supporting rod (11), and the top ends of the reinforcing rods (12) are fixedly connected with the lower surface of the supporting plate (10).
3. The formwork fixing structure for the arched structure construction of a house building according to claim 1, wherein the wall of the bolt (6) is movably sleeved with a cushion block (13).
4. The formwork fixing structure for the arched structure construction of a house building according to claim 1, wherein the lower surface of the bolt (6) is fixedly connected with two symmetrically distributed twist bars (14).
5. The formwork fixing structure for house building arch structure construction according to claim 2, wherein a rubber pad is fixedly connected to the upper surface of the supporting plate (10).
6. The formwork fixing structure for the arched structure construction of a house building according to claim 1, wherein a rotating rod (15) is fixedly connected to the outer wall of the threaded cylinder (8).
